titleOfInvention Stabilized pesticide composition
abstract PURPOSE: To provide the titled composition obtained by adding sulfosalicylic acid as a stabilizer to a pesticide containing tricyclazole and an organophosphate compound as active components, thereby suppressing the chemical reaction between both active components with only a small amount of the stabilizer without lowering the activity of the active components. n CONSTITUTION: A pesticide containing (A) 5-methyl-1,2,4-triazolo(3,4-b)benzothiazole (tricyclazole) and (B) an organophosphate compound such as S-1,2-bis (ethoxycarbonyl)-ethyl-O,O-dimethyldithiophosphoric acid ester (malathion), etc. is added with (C) sulfosalicylic acid as a stabilizer to suppress the lowering of the activity caused by the reaction of the active components A and B. The weight ratios of the components B and C to A are 2:1W1:10 and 10:0.5W1:10, respectively. Since the component C exhibits the stabilizing effect at a low dose compared with conventional stabilizer, the phytotoxicity of acids can be mitigated. n COPYRIGHT: (C)1985,JPO&Japio
